Fire Crews Quickly Contain Residential Blaze Near Edgewood Court in Plainfield
PLAINFIELD, Ind. — Firefighters from multiple departments responded to a residential fire in Plainfield on Sunday afternoon, bringing the situation under control within minutes of arriving.
According to dispatch information, crews from the Plainfield, Mooresville, and Decatur Township Fire Departments were sent to the area of Edgewood Court and Timberwood Court at approximately 2:38 p.m. for a reported house fire.
First-arriving units encountered fire conditions at the scene, but firefighters were able to act quickly, knocking down the flames within about seven minutes of their arrival. The rapid response helped prevent the fire from spreading further and limited the duration of the incident.
At this time, officials have not released information regarding injuries, the extent of damage to the home, or what may have caused the fire. An investigation into the incident is expected.
